Facebook agrees to buy WhatsApp for $16 billion
SAN FRANCISCO — In one of the biggest technology deals of the past decade, Facebook agreed to buy WhatsApp for $16 billion to expand in the fast-growing mobile messaging market and pursue its goal of connecting as much of the world’s population as possible over the Internet. Facebook said it will pay $4 billion in cash and $12 billion in stock for WhatsApp, a service that has 450 million monthly users and is adding more than 1 million new users a day. “WhatsApp is on a path to connect 1 billion people. The services that reach that milestone are all incredibly valuable,” Facebook CEO Mark Zuckerberg said in a statement announcing the deal.
